The Cybersecurity Fraud Analyst  conducts in-depth analyses and correlation of data points to model Proactive Call Center Detection/Prevention and investigate risks to UHG. 

 

You’ll enjoy the flexibility to work remotely * from anywhere within the U.S. as you take on some tough challenges. 

 

Primary Responsibilities: 

  • Review logs and indicators to identify, analyze, document, and report on actions or behaviors as observed by security logs that are risky, do not align to company policies, or are otherwise deemed suspicious
  • Correlate data points from various sources to support identification of anomalous behavior using critical thinking skills
  • Alert those that need to know by providing clear and detailed information to help address the perceived risk and drive corrective actions and resolution after reporting
  • Continually learn, adapt, and feed-forward those findings to what is and is not risky behavior based on prior notifications, changes in policies, and changes in security logs including applying lessons learned from past incidents
  • Translate business risks to threat monitoring use cases for alerting, including conducting risk assessments on data sources for ingestion into monitoring tools
  • Collaborate with partner teams to support investigations processes, provide technical expertise as needed, and communicate risks to the business
  • Mentor and train other analysts on investigative techniques and analytical and technical skills.
  • May assist with sophisticated cybersecurity incidents, investigations, and maintaining chain of custody when needed to support legal requirements

Required Qualifications: 

  • Undergraduate degree or prior systems security or cyber experience
  • 1+ years of experience monitoring systems and analyzing data
  • 1+ years of experience working as an analyst working sensitive information ethically and responsibly
  • 1+ years of In-depth understanding of cybersecurity principles, technologies, and tools
  • 1+ years of Proficiency in interpreting and analyzing data to uncover potential cyber threats
  • 1+ years of ability to resolve security incidences efficiently

 

Preferred Qualification:  

  • Pindrop experience
